In fulfilling this responsibility, the Committee shall:
- Meet with the external auditors and review the results of the annual financial
statement audit, and approve such statements for recommendation to the Board;
- Review other sections of the annual report, including Management's Discussion and
Analysis,
and any report or opinion that the auditors propose to render;
- Review and discuss with management and the external auditors significant variances,
estimates and accruals, judgments, changes in accounting policies and standards, and issues concerning litigation or contingencies;
- Review with the administration and the internal and external auditors their evaluation of the University's internal
controls and assess the steps management has taken to minimize significant risks or exposures;
- Review and discuss with management significant financial risk exposures and the steps management has taken to monitor and manage these financial risks;
- Review and discuss with management that adequate procedures and processes are in place to ensure the integrity of the financial statements; and
- Review the appropriateness of significant accounting principles and practices, unusual or extraordinary items, transactions with related parties and the adequacy of disclosures.
